Thinking of ordering these rules but haven't seen much feedback yet?

John Leahy Sponsoring Member of TMP24 Jun 2020 5:25 p.m. PST

I bought them and have read thru them. I have watched the game play video on Youtube. I think Wargames Illustrated did it. The mechanics are similar to Iron Cross although it's tailored for WWI. I want to play but with Covid have had to wait.
